À quoi s'attendre
1
St. Mark's-in-the-Bowery Church
Meet your guide outside Little Poland in the East Village to begin your walk through the historic area. See historic and colonial St. Mark's in the Bowery Church, the burial place of Peter Stuyvesant, the last Dutch Governor General of New Amsterdam. Stroll down Second Avenue with its Little Germany turn-of-the-century architecture. See funky St. Mark's Place, current and former home to Beatniks, punk rockers, and jazz greats. St. Mark's Place has various Thai, Afghani, and pub grub culinary options.  It was also home to Andy Warhol's Night Club and the 19th century German American Shooting Gallery. Come taste, savor, and learn NYC's East Village and its rich, old world history.

My adult daughter and I did the Pierogi Tour. Greg was a great communicator and worked with us when the original tour time didn't work for him. We had a lovely early spring day and that helped make it an enjoyable walk through the East Village. It was more than a food tour -- he talked about architecture and history of the neighborhood. Since the tour had been called a "Pierogi Walking Tour" when we signed up, I had expected to taste pierogi from various places, but instead we got a variety of Polish (and a few other Eastern European countries) food -- which wasn't a bad thing, but I'm glad to see it's now labeled as a Polish Food Tour which is more accurate (but note, we did get pierogi among all the variety!). I'm glad we had a nice day since all of the eating took place outside of the establishments (I'm not sure how that would have gone on a cold, rainy day), but we both learned things about a neighborhood we'd already spent a lot of time in and Greg was a pleasure to talk to. Oh -- and the food and the leftovers we got to take back with us were all delicious!
